Gallery We is featuring the solo exhibition of So Hyung Kim, who paints the various images of the world and people in patterning and graphing. In works, she makes a space of pattern beyond a time and space. A space has been changed from a emotional landscape focusing on texture to one in expressionism emphasizing colors, and she recently changed it into graphed one to symbolize a preface of unified city structure.
In this exhibition, the artist focuses on a story of avatar and a cube-shaped space where loses the distinct characteristics of the certain area. Recent works show cubes in wild and sharp shape. And there is avatar instead of a human. The artist reflects a belief in lost space and nostalgia on a landscape of uniformed cubes. Avatars are the artist's story and applied to individual story of people in the contemporary society as well.
